Samsung NB30 netbook rolls out
Samsung has introduced its latest NB30 netbook in South Korea, where it is capable of running up to 11 hours under assured conditions – expect real-world usage to shave off a couple of hours from the stated figure, even more so whether you have many windows open simultaneously with a bunch of other programs running in the background to push the processor even more. Featuring a 10.1″ LED anti-reflective display, the NB30 is additionally equipped with an integrated Digital LiveCam, a mark and scratch-resistant durable exteriro, a hard drive freefall sensor to protect your input in the event of a drop/fall, a water tight seal that prevents potential damage from contact with up to 50 cc of spilled water, and of course, the latest Pine Trail processor from Intel (Atom N450). No view on pricing, but expect the Samsung NB30 to hit most of the world sometime that month, hopefully for an affordable price. [Press Release]
